Some Common Brake Actuator Issues 

Slowed or Delayed Brake Response 

This is primarily the most common issue reported by drivers where they counter a delayed and less responsive brake. There can be multiple reasons behind this delayed response, i.e.,

Hydraulic leaks: Hydraulic fluid is the main agent that creates pressure in the braking system. Even a slight drop in hydraulic fluid levels due to leakages may weaken the braking system and cause delays.

Contaminated brake fluid: Any kind of impurities in hydraulic fluid, like water, dirt, or any other contaminants, may affect the efficiency of the braking system, leading to sluggish actuator performance.

Worn-out seals and valves: seals and valves inside the actuator are subject to wear and tear over time. This wear and tear significantly affects the pressure and, consequently, the performance. 

Inconsistent Brake Force 

This is another common issue where the drivers may feel inconsistency in the braking force applied. Some signs may include 

Uneven braking pressure: When the flawed brake actuator fails to distribute pressure evenly, it causes jerky stops or pulling to the one side, which is fatal in heavily loaded vehicles

Faulty sensors: Modern brake actuators contain advanced sensors that measure and distribute brake force. Faulty sensors can certainly lead to uneven brake application.

Air trapped in lines: Air trapped in the hydraulic system disrupts the pressure mechanism and compresses under pressure, leading to inconsistent brake force.   

Noisy Operation 

The standard braking system is noise-free, so the noisy operation might be a symptom of underlying issues such as,

Worn-out components: When some parts of the system, like gears or bushings, wear out, they cause grinding, squeaking, or clicking noises within the brake actuator

Contaminated brake pads: Any kind of debris or dirt on brake pads can cause loud, annoying noises and sounds and further reduce the braking efficiency of the system

Improper lubrication: Lack of proper lubrication or use of improper lubricant in hydraulic brake actuator causes increased friction and resultant noise in the braking system. 

Troubleshooting Brake Actuator Issues 

Hydraulic Leak Diagnosis 

Diagnosing hydraulic leaks is simple and easy. Just visually inspect or feel by touching the hydraulic lines, seals, and connections. See for any signs of leakage across the surface of actuator lines. The affected part must be repaired or replaced instantly if a leak is detected. 

Chart: Common Areas of Hydraulic Leaks 

ComponentPotential IssueAction Required 
Brake lines Cracks or corrosion Replace damaged sections 
Actuator seals Worn or damaged sealsReplace seals and gaskets 
Brake fluid reservoirLow fluid levelCheck for leaks 

Identifying Contaminated Brake Fluid 

Contaminated brake fluid can again be inspected visually. Observe for any drastic change in color or consistency. Further, you can use a brake fluid tester for a better idea to measure the fluid’s boiling point and moisture content. If contamination is confirmed, perform a full fluid flush and replace it with fresh fluid. 

Fixing Inconsistent Brake Force 

In this particular issue, you can begin by bleeding the brake lines to remove any trapped air which will disrupt the whole mechanism. Further, you can check for malfunctioning sensors and recalibrate or even replace them if faulty. Just ensure that the brake actuator distributes pressure evenly across all wheels.

Fixing Noisy Operation 

As we discussed earlier, noisy operation is caused due to excessive friction caused by insufficient lubrication. So initially, lubricate the actuator components. If the issue persists, check for brake pads and rotors for contamination. Also, replace any worn-out components within the hydraulic brake actuator.

Precautionary Maintenance 

Precautionary or preventive maintenance is the key to avoiding brake failures and common issues right in advance. Here are some common practices:

Periodic fluid checks: Regularly inspect for the fluid levels and any kind of contamination in the automatic hydraulic surge brake. Keep the levels maintained and replace fluid if contaminated.

Regular Inspections: Check the actuator components, brake lines, and sensors for wear and tear over time.

Proper lubrication: just make sure that all moving parts are sufficiently lubricated with recommended lubricant to prevent friction and noise.
